Back End Engineer - Titan Job in Directi Group

Back End Engineer - Titan

Apply Now
Job Summary

What is the Job like?

    • Design and develop large scale distributed services
    • Design and implement new user-facing features
    • Take ownership of one or more components of the platform and drive innovation in your area of ownership
    • Analyze and improve the efficiency, scalability, stability, and security of the platform as a whole
    • Work closely with product management and UX design teams to define and refine feature specifications
    • Manage individual project priorities, deadlines, and deliverablesParticipate actively in recruitment and nurturing of engineers as awesome as you

Who should apply for this role?

    • 3+ years of experience with a solid foundation in computer science and strong competency in data structures,algorithms, and software design
    • Java expert. Experience with golang, python, or other languages is a plus
    • Good understanding of nuances of distributed systems, scalability, and availability
    • Good knowledge of one or more relational and NoSQL databases and transactions
    • In-depth understanding of concurrency, synchronization, NIO, memory allocation, and GC
    • Experience with IaaS clouds like AWS/Google Cloud, Azure, OpenStack, etc
    • Experience in a startup environment is a plus
    • Good communication skills. Putting your thoughts through to other stakeholders in a cohesive manner is not a problem for you.
Experience Required :

Minimum 3 Years

Vacancy :

2 - 4 Hires

Similar Jobs for you

See more recommended jobs